George Gerhart
HONOREE'S STORY
Buhl Boulevard, Sharon.
EDUCATION: Earned a bachelor's in psychology at Penn State University; earned a master of arts degree in counseling and in college student personnel administration from Penn State University.
MILITARY SERVICE: Captain in the U.S. Army Field Artillery for 4‡ years; including a year in Vietnam as an aerial and ground forward observer and intelligence officer in the First Cavalry Division.
EMPLOYMENT: Financial aid officer at Penn State Shenango. Employed by the University for 30 years -- eight at Fayette campus and 22 at Shenango campus.
FAMILY: Married to Nancy Gerhart for 34 years, three children and one grandson.
COMMUNITY SERVICE:
Member of First United Methodist Church of Sharon, where he chairs the administrative board; teaches Sunday school; is a member of the sanctuary choir and United Methodist Men.
Involved in Western Pennsylvania Conference of the United Methodist Church where he is director of the Lay Leadership Training School for the district; chairman of the Higher Education Scholarship Committee; member of the Bishop's Committee on the Episcopacy; has served as chairman and member of several committees.
Worship leader/preacher at the Shenango Campground service sponsored each summer by Christian Associates of the Shenango Valley.
Current secretary and past president, Kiwanis Club of Sharon.
Member of the Shenango Valley Intergovernmental Study Committee and its coordinating committee.
Member of ERASE, an anti-drug coalition.
Member of the judging panel for The Herald High School Academic All Stars Awards program.
Member of the worship service committee of the Mercer County Bicentennial Commission.
Past president for 10 years of the Academic Boosters Club of Sharon High School.
Member of the strategic planning committee of the Sharon City Public Schools.
Coordinator of the Highway Clean-up Program of Penn State Shenango at the Route 60/Interstate 80 interchange.
Member of the executive board of the former Contact Penn-Ohio, a telephone helpline.
Former loan executive for the United Way of Mercer County and member of the United Way Committee at Penn State Shenango.
Neighborhood 'Mother' for the Mothers March of Dimes.
